Default Forged pistons @ 15psi on stock sleeves(h22)??? Something seems fishy...

Ok, well im done taking apart my h22 and am ready to start the turbo build up. The VERY first thing on my list was to get the block sleeved as I was under the notion that to run any forged pistons, especially under the added pressure of forced induction, would require me re-sleeving the block.

So I mozzy on down to the ONLY local honda performance shop "Sonic Boom Motorsports". They guy behind the counter tells me that my block should be just fine @ 15psi so long as my fuel and timing were correct. But if I did want to turn up the boost above around 18psi for track use that I should get re-sleeved.

Does it seem ok to run forged pistons on the STOCK BLOCK???? Just wondering if this guy new what he was talking about...thanks.

Due to the FRM liner with the H series motors you cannot run forged pistons because it will sooner or later 'gum' up. Wiseco were supposed to have a special piston with rings that you can run with stock sleeves but this has not once been verified. Wiseco has spent a LONG time redesigning the piston skirt and I believe they recommend to run a certain type coating on the skirt as well so they are compatible with the stock sleeves. You can do an archived search in the prelude forum for 'resleeving' and you will come up with all the info you ever need plus the pictures of what happens when you run a forged piston in a FRM lined cylinder wall.

Another thing 'sonic boom' forgot to tell you about are the weak ringlands that the H series pistons have. After around 10psi you will eventually break them. Firedrake has managed a bit over 300whp with 11psi on his h22a for a while now with no problems, but keep in mind he has a rebuilt planned in the near future.

doesn't the h22 have two different blocks one close deck and one open deck

does the closed deck block need to get resleeved also? does anyone know from
experience?

92-96 are closed decks and 97 up are open decks

All years use FRM lined cylinder walls. Yes, the closed need to be resleeved as well. You can sleeve both open and closed deck or use the Darton closed deck conversion kits for the open's to make them closed.
